Design and presentation

When you get the kit, you receive the PAX 3 vaporizer, one charging cable + dock, two mouthpieces, one multi-tool, two oven lids, one concentrates insert, one o-ring for the concentrates insert and three replacement screens. The PAX 3 can be used with concentrates and herbs. It features high-polished anodized aluminum shell and it is lightweight and discreet. You can choose between Gold, Black, Rose Gold (limited edition) and Silver. You can get it from $200 USD.

Pax Labs knows that first impressions count, which is why it is not a surprise to see that they use a high quality box for their device. Once you open it, you will be welcomed by the glossy new PAX. While the PAX 3 looks a lot like the previous model, it offers additional features that its predecessor didn’t have. For instance, it allows you to vape concentrates.

Features

There are 4 temperature settings and the device heats up way faster than the PAX 2. It comes with heptic feedback, which means that the vibrations will let you know when the vapor is ready as it enters standby mode. You can see how much battery is left thanks to the full-color LED interface. With the internal accelerometer you can save energy and material. The 1500 mAh battery in the PAX 3 is slightly larger than the one in the previous version and it offers more power. The PAX 3 supports Bluetooth and it works with the PAX Vapor app. The warranty covers the device for 10 years.

You can use the app to adjust the temperature, which is an innovative solution that will impress technology fans. The app also includes entertaining games and you can connect it to the PAX 3 via Bluetooth. You just need to pair your smartphone with the PAX 3 and use the app to manage different functions. Apart from allowing you to adjust the vaping temperature, the PAX 3 offers some modes that will suit different needs. When you use the Boost mode, auto-cooling is reduced so keep in mind that the device can get a bit too hot when using this mode. The Stealth mode increases cooling and keeps lights to a minimum, which is ideal for discreet vaping. With the Efficiency mode, the temperature increases gradually and with the Flavor mode, you can adjust the temperature to your liking and get the richest flavor.

There is a feature called Haptics, which makes the PAX 3 vibrate to let you know when it is ready to be used. You can disable this feature or adjust it to suit your preferences. The PAX 3 can be used with dry herbs or concentrates, and if you are using it for the latter, you just need to place a little bit in the middle of the wax chamber. When vaping concentrates, the best option is to select the highest setting. Although it doesn’t deliver massive clouds, it provides an enjoyable and intense flavor, with no burning sensation. You get strong hits, but the sensation is smooth. The PAX 3 is designed to offer a consistent experience, whether you want to vape wax of herbs. Concentrates can last for a long time and thankfully, the wax chamber is easy to clean.

One of the reasons why many people prefer the PAX 3 over the previous version is that it heats up faster. If you prefer to vape wax, you will enjoy the stop-and-go sessions and will only need a small amount of concentrate. The vapor production and flavor are at the same level in the PAX 3 and the PAX 2, although it feels like the new model lets you take smoother draws. The oven in the new PAX is set to offer more powerful performance and the battery life has been increased. The device is versatile and its portability and discreet design makes it perfect for on the go sessions.
